In our area, outside Quantico, camp slots fill quickly in February.  Our favorite county camp is Multi-Sport, a different sport every day.  What if the county camps are full?  Check local private schools to see if they are hosting camps, such as this Art and Drama Camp. Sylvan Camps for openings.  We tried a Sylvan, STEM camp at the local fitness center one time.  The instructor used LEGO STEM kits.  Sadly, she just read the instructions to the kids.  Not the most fun. I’m sure some instructors are better at making STEM fun.   Some of the Catholic High Schools offer Sports Camps.  What about library, summer programs? Yes, mainly these are reading programs; check for special events.  Try Museums or Colleges, too.  Hey!  If these options are too expensive or unavailable, plan a cousin camp!
